The Neuralink event will now take place on November 30th.
Billionaire Elon Musk said in a tweet on Sunday that he has postponed Neuralink’s “show & tell” event by a month to November 30 and did not provide further information.
The CEO of electric car maker Tesla Inc and rocket developer SpaceX said in August that the event would take place on October 31.
Founded by Musk in 2016, San Francisco-based company aims to implant wireless computer chips in the brain to help treat neurological conditions such as Alzheimer’s disease, dementia, and spinal cord injury and to integrate humanity with artificial intelligence.
Musk said in a 2019 report that Neuralink aims to gain regulatory approval for human microchip implant trials by the end of 2020, the company has yet to obtain that approval or bring a product to market.
Musk contacted brain-chip developer Synchron Inc about a potential investment after expressing frustration with Neuralink employees over their slow progress in obtaining regulatory clearance for his devices.
